Xi Jinping's Russia visit highlights China's global ambitions.

TL;DR Summary
Chinese President Xi Jinping is visiting Russia in hopes of mediating a breakthrough on the Ukraine conflict, positioning China as a peacemaker on the global stage. Xi's trip aims to show support for his strategic partner, Russia, without resulting in sanctions. China has long sought to depict itself as a neutral party to the conflict, but has refused to condemn Russia's invasion and has been criticized for providing diplomatic cover. While China has published a 12-point position paper and touted its Global Security Initiative, both have drawn ire in the West for dwelling on broad principles instead of practical solutions to the crisis.
